Houston Texans quarterback C.J. Stroud still in concussion protocol but making progress to return
After missing three games with a concussion, Texans quarterback C.J. Stroud has not yet been cleared to play against Indianapolis.
The Houston Texans have six more games to cement their legacy as the seventh team ever to make the playoffs after going 0-3… the last team being the 2018 Houston Texans. According to CBS Sports, “since the NFL schedule was expanded to 17 games in 2021, NO team has lost their first three games and rebounded to make the postseason.”
